Show simple item record

Real-time physiological identification using incremental learning and semi-supervised learning

dc.contributor.authorShivarudrappa, Shashank
dc.contributor.advisorDehzangi, Omid
dc.date.accessioned2018-05-07T14:47:40Z
dc.date.availableNO_RESTRICTIONen_US
dc.date.available2018-05-07T14:47:40Z
dc.date.issued2018-04-29
dc.date.submitted2018-04-10
dc.identifier.urihttps://hdl.handle.net/2027.42/143516
dc.description.abstractThe widespread usage of wearable sensors such as smart watches provide access to valuable objective physiological (such as Electrocardiogram(ECG)) signals ubiquitously. Healthcare domain has been tremendously benefited by the collection of physiological signals which can be used for health monitoring of patients. The signals from the wearable sensors enabled the researchers and data experts to process them and identify the human physiological state by classifying the human activities. This led to the growth and development of smart ecosystem in the healthcare domain.In this thesis, ECG signals have been investigated as the physiological measure to detect human activities. Various measures are extracted from ECG, such as heart rate variability, average heart rate etc. and their relationships with different human activities are investigated. To build a comprehensive analytical machine learning model for ECG signals and to enable the continuous monitoring of humans, one would need access to real time streaming of continuous data. So, the data would be unsupervised most of the time and it would be very expensive (almost practically impossible) to label all the data streaming in real time. Also, it is highly probable that the data is collected from different sessions and varying situations. Therefore, the machine learning models need to be able to adapt to new sessions. This would be a major challenge in human state monitoring provided that the conventional predictive models work only on the stationary data. Also, these models would fail to work on the data from multiple sessions. To provide a practical solution to address above issues, two advanced methods in machine learning have been discussed in this research: Incremental learning and Semi supervised learning. Incremental learning is a paradigm in Machine learning where the stream of input data is continuously used to extend the existing knowledge learnt by the model. The incremental learning module has been built in Apache Spark platform which provides a scalable cloud infrastructure to apply machine learning algorithms on streaming data. Semi supervised learning is another solution implemented in this thesis where some out of all the data points are labelled. Different semi supervised algorithms have been studied and applied which learn the relationship between features and adapts the model to data from multiple sessions. Finally, the results are compared and the implementation ideas for the discussed solutions have been proposed.en_US
dc.language.isoen_USen_US
dc.subjectPhysiological monitoringen_US
dc.subjectWearable sensorsen_US
dc.subjectElectrocardiogramen_US
dc.subjectIncremental learningen_US
dc.subjectSemi-supervised learningen_US
dc.subject.otherComputer scienceen_US
dc.titleReal-time physiological identification using incremental learning and semi-supervised learningen_US
dc.typeThesisen_US
dc.description.thesisdegreenameMaster of Science (MS)en_US
dc.description.thesisdegreedisciplineComputer and Information Science, College of Engineering & Computer Scienceen_US
dc.description.thesisdegreegrantorUniversity of Michigan-Dearbornen_US
dc.contributor.committeememberAkingbehin, Kiumi
dc.contributor.committeememberMedjahed, Brahim
dc.identifier.uniqname62471891en_US
dc.description.bitstreamurlhttps://deepblue.lib.umich.edu/bitstream/2027.42/143516/1/49698122_Thesis_Shashank_Shivarudrappa.pdf
dc.identifier.orcid0000-0003-4496-0153en_US
dc.description.filedescriptionDescription of 49698122_Thesis_Shashank_Shivarudrappa.pdf : Thesis
dc.identifier.name-orcidShivarudrappa, Shashank; 0000-0003-4496-0153en_US
dc.owningcollnameDissertations and Theses (Ph.D. and Master's)


Files in this item

Show simple item record

Remediation of Harmful Language

The University of Michigan Library aims to describe library materials in a way that respects the people and communities who create, use, and are represented in our collections. Report harmful or offensive language in catalog records, finding aids, or elsewhere in our collections anonymously through our metadata feedback form. More information at Remediation of Harmful Language.

Accessibility

If you are unable to use this file in its current format, please select the Contact Us link and we can modify it to make it more accessible to you.